I think there are a bunch of ways to work your way into an ER position. I know a bunch of people who went non traditional routes. One guy worked in IR at a water company and then did ER specializing in water utilities. Another guy worked for a smaller PE shop, got his CFA and then went into ER. Another guy went right from the MSF. All depends. If you get specialized industry experience and have the chops then you can break in.
I'd keep networking and have the MSF as a great back up. I think you can do it without it, but if you had a mediocre GPA or went to an unheard of school, then the MSF might be in order.
